Связать данные по интервалам. Пример IntervalMatch Qlik Sense

В этой статье будет рассмотрены примеры использования функции IntervalMatch. Рассмотрим пример [tester_signal]: LOAD Signal_datetime, Signal_symbol, “symbol”, indicator, “1d”, “6h”, “1h” FROM [lib://DataFiles/tester_signal.qvd] (qvd); NoConcatenate [TEMP tester_price_changes]: LOAD datetime, “symbol”, last_price, price_change, price_change_percent, high_price, low_price, volume, weighted_avg_price, quote_volume FROM [lib://DataFiles/tester_price_changes.qvd] (qvd); [TEMP max_datetime]: Load max(datetime) as max_datetime Resident [TEMP tester_price_changes]; LET Читать дальше…

Дизайн дашборда Qlik Sense. Проектирование, разработка, MAD (DAR) концепции

В этой статье будут рассмотрены основные подходы, методы дизайна дашборда Qlik Sense. Из каких элементов состоит дашборд Qlik Sense, концепция DAR (Dashboard – Analysis – Report). Qlik Sense Expert – Дизайн дашборда Qlik Sense Что такое дашборд? Вот ряд определений, что же такое дашборд: Дашборд (информационная панель, панель мониторинга для Читать дальше…

Data tables и Symbol tables QIX Engine

Symbol tables (Таблицы символов) содержат только отдельные значения полей: индексы с битовой вставкой и их значения в виде открытого текста Compressed Data table (Сжатая таблица данных) содержит то же количество столбцов и строк, что и их исходные, но заполнена битовыми индексами и, следовательно, чрезвычайно компактна Семь основных компонентов QIX Engine Читать дальше…

Основные компоненты приложения Qlik Sense для визуализации данных

Составные части приложения Qlik Sense Независимо от того, в какой версии Qlik Sense Вы работаете (Desktop или Enterprise), Вы встретитесь со следующими понятиями: Приложение Qlik Sense – это данные + визуализация в одном файле. При открытии приложения (в desktop или на сервере) данные из файла (qvf или бинарного файла в Читать дальше…

Qlik Sense ETL & ELT: Основы загрузки данных из систем учета, баз данных, файлов

Что такое ETL & ELT? В чем отличие? Как та или иная технология может быть применима в Qlik Sense Извлечение, загрузка и преобразование (ELT) — это процесс, с помощью которого данные извлекаются из исходной системы, загружаются в хранилище данных, а затем преобразовываются. E, T, L: Extraction (Извлечение): извлечение необработанных данных Читать дальше…

Фишки (Tips & Tricks) по Qlik Sense / QlikView. Секретные приемы Qlik

Фишки по коду и выражениям (script & expression) Количество выбранных элементов в измерении GetSelectedCount([Товар Название]) Количество возможных элементов в измерении GetPossibleCount([Товар Название]) Получить количество полей из таблицы модели =Count({1<$Table={‘Таблица Фактов’}>} $Field) Переменная “Условие-проверка”, что приложение Qlik перегрузилось сегодня vAppReload =match(today(0),today(2)) Получить в скрипте текст, заключенный между символами Текст между символами: Читать дальше…

Проверка консистентности/достоверности данных. Подходы контроля правильной работы ETL-скрипта

Введение todo Подходы контроля правильной работы ETL-скрипта. Best Practices Qlik Sense Development Контроль количества строк при операциях Left Join Контроль полноты данных Для контроля полноты данных следите за: Количество записей Контрольная сумма по мере Статистические таблицы Рекомендации по организации ETL-процесса и управлению скриптами Комментарии в скрипте 1. Наличие в коде Читать дальше…

Конструктор отчетов Qlik Sense. AdHoc Reporting. Гибкий отчет с измерениями и показателями

Что такое конструктор отчетов Qlik Sense (Qlik AdHoc Report)? В строгом смысле, Конструктор отчетов Qlik Sense – это отчет, который создается на лету и отображает информацию в виде таблицы, которая является результатом вопроса, который еще не был выведен в отдельный рабочий отчет. Существует ограничение на количество таких производственных отчетов и Читать дальше…

Этапы проекта Qlik Sense. Краткий обзор состава работ по проекту

Введение Qlik Project Steps Qlik Sense – очень гибкая платформа создания отчетности. В ней нет ограничений на количество приложений, на количество отчетов, количество данных. Вы можете создать 1 большое приложение с множеством различных отчетов, либо создать много приложений, в каждом из которых будет 1-2 сложных по структуре или логике отчета. Читать дальше…

LFL Календарь. Накопительный календарь Qlik. The As-Of Table. YTD, MTD, WTD, QTD / LYTQ, LQTD, LMTD, LWTD

В этой статье речь пойдет про накопительный календарь и календарь с флагами для расчета LFL показателей, например, продажи за последние 90 дней текущего месяца к продажам за аналогичный период предыдущего года (т.е. 90 дней прошлого года). Для начала рассмотрим упрощенный пример LFL Календаря. LFL Календарь Qlik Sense (для расчета показателей Читать дальше…